AT90PWM1-16MU Atmel, AT90PWM1-16MU Datasheet - Page 192

no-image

AT90PWM1-16MU

Manufacturer Part Number
AT90PWM1-16MU
Description
IC AVR PWM 8KB FLASH 16MHZ 32QFN
Manufacturer
Atmel
Series
AVR® 90PWM Lightingr
Datasheet

Specifications of AT90PWM1-16MU

Core Processor
AVR
Core Size
8-Bit
Speed
16MHz
Connectivity
SPI
Peripherals
Brown-out Detect/Reset, POR, PWM, WDT
Number Of I /o
19
Program Memory Size
8KB (8K x 8)
Program Memory Type
FLASH
Eeprom Size
512 x 8
Ram Size
512 x 8
Voltage - Supply (vcc/vdd)
2.7 V ~ 5.5 V
Data Converters
A/D 8x10b
Oscillator Type
Internal
Operating Temperature
-40°C ~ 105°C
Package / Case
32-QFN
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
19.7
192
ADC Conversion Result
AT90PWM1
Figure 19-13. Differential Non-linearity (DNL)
After the conversion is complete (ADIF is high), the conversion result can be found in the ADC
Result Registers (ADCL, ADCH).
For single ended conversion, the result is:
where V
Table 62 on page 194
represents the selected reference voltage.
If differential channels are used, the result is:
where V
GAIN the selected gain factor and V
in two’s complement form, from 0x200 (-512d) through 0x1FF (+511d). Note that if the user
wants to perform a quick polarity check of the result, it is sufficient to read the MSB of the result
(ADC9 in ADCH). If the bit is one, the result is negative, and if this bit is zero, the result is posi-
tive.
Table 82 shows the resulting output codes if the differential input channel pair (ADCn - ADCm) is
selected with a reference voltage of V
Quantization Error: Due to the quantization of the input voltage into a finite number of codes,
a range of input voltages (1 LSB wide) will code to the same value. Always ± 0.5 LSB.
Absolute Accuracy: The maximum deviation of an actual (unadjusted) transition compared
to an ideal transition for any code. This is the compound effect of offset, gain error,
differential error, non-linearity, and quantization error. Ideal value: ± 0.5 LSB.
Figure 19-14
IN
POS
is the voltage on the selected input pin and V
is the voltage on the positive input pin, V
Output Code
shows the decoding of the differential input range.
0x000
0x3FF
and
0
Table 63 on page
1 LSB
ADC
REF
REF
ADC
=
the selected voltage reference. The result is presented
.
(
----------------------------------------------------------------------- -
V
=
POS
195). 0x000 represents analog ground, and 0x3FF
V
--------------------------
IN
V
REF
V
1023
NEG
NEG
V
REF
REF
) GAIN 512
the voltage on the negative input pin,
the selected voltage reference (see
V
REF
Input Voltage
4378C–AVR–09/08

Related parts for AT90PWM1-16MU